  6. Handle wildcard in url mapping

    Could it be possible in the future to handle wildcard in url mapping ?

    As a web developer, i'm using dev environments, so urls are something like https://mywebsite-pr-*.fr/. Currently, it doesn't recognize url and doesn't propose me to autofill password.

    Manually search then copy the credentials is kind of cumbersome. Thanks for your time reading !

  11. Username & Email for single ProtonPass saved Login

    Currently you can only save either a username or your email with a single login in proton pass.

    However some services may require a registration with an email-address and then have the login process only working with a username.

    Id would be really helpful if you could save both in a single saved login in ProtonPass. You also could then add the ability to decide which one of these is primarly used for logins.

  12. Allow Proton Authenticator to Sync codes to Proton cloud.

    Allow Proton Authenticator to Sync codes to Proton cloud.

    Google allows me to sync my list of Authenticator codes to my account in the cloud.
    If I lose my mobile phone, and can access my Google account via a recovery method, I can then access all of my data, including my Authenticator codes list, and re-download it onto the Google Authenticator app on a new phone, and I am back up and running.

    Without this cloud sync feature, I am wary of adopting Proton Authenticator since losing my phone amounts to losing access to all services - and potentially finances/crypto.
